Langage C et Python : scénarios applicables et analyse des avantages et des inconvénients
Dans le domaine de la programmation informatique, le langage C et Python sont deux langages de programmation très populaires. Ils présentent chacun des avantages et des inconvénients uniques et conviennent à différents scénarios. . Cet article procédera à une analyse approfondie du langage C et de Python, discutant de leurs scénarios applicables, de leurs avantages et de leurs inconvénients.
1. Langage C
Le langage C est un langage de programmation orienté processus avec une efficacité élevée et d'excellentes performances. Il convient au développement de logiciels système, de pilotes et de systèmes embarqués qui nécessitent un haut degré. de contrôle et d’efficacité du système, etc. En raison de sa capacité à exploiter directement la mémoire, le langage C peut mieux gérer les détails de bas niveau et convient aux scénarios d'application nécessitant des performances de calcul élevées.
Exemple de code :
#include <stdio.h> int main() { int a = 5; int b = 10; int c = a + b; printf("The sum of a and b is: %d ", c); return 0; }
2. Python
Python est un langage de programmation interprété de haut niveau avec une syntaxe concise et facile à lire et une bibliothèque standard riche, adapté au développement rapide de prototypes et applications Programmation, analyse de données et intelligence artificielle. En raison de sa grande efficacité de développement et du soutien étendu de la communauté, Python est largement utilisé dans le développement Web, le calcul scientifique, les tests automatisés et d'autres domaines.
Exemple de code :
# Python示例代码 a = 5 b = 10 c = a + b print("The sum of a and b is:", c)
Résumé :
Le langage C convient aux scénarios avec des exigences de performances élevées et un contrôle de bas niveau, tandis que Python convient au développement rapide et aux applications de maintenance faciles. Lorsque les développeurs choisissent un langage de programmation, ils doivent choisir les outils appropriés en fonction des besoins réels, exploiter pleinement les avantages du langage et améliorer l'efficacité du développement et les performances du programme.
Ce qui précède est une analyse des scénarios applicables ainsi que des avantages et inconvénients du langage C et de Python. J'espère que cela sera utile aux lecteurs.
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!